TravelPerk: Raises $160M in Series D Funding

  • TravelPerk, a Barcelona, Spain-based travel management platform, raised $160m in Series D equity and debt funding
  • The round, which brought the total funding raised to date to $294m, was led by Greyhound Capital, with participation from existing investors
  • The company also intends to use the funds to accelerate global growth, with a particular focus on the US and Europe and to grow its 500-person team
  • Led by Avi Meir, CEO and co-founder, TravelPerk provides a travel platform for booking, managing and reporting business trips, using its proprietary technology and 24/7 traveler support
  • The platform hosts the a large bookable travel inventory, allowing travelers to compare, book and invoice trains, cars, flights, hotels and apartments from a range of providers
  • In the last year, the company released a range of new solutions including TravelSafe, a product for the wider travel industry
